1.简单介绍
mxGraph是一个JS绘图组件适用于需要在网页中设计/编辑Workflow/BPM流程图、图表、网络图和普通图形的Web应用程序。
下载:http://www.mxgraph.com/downloads/mxgraph/eval/
示例:http://www.mxgraph.com/demo.html
2.破解方法说明
1)只要是js,必然会下载到本地
2)用fiddler (用了很久的绝世好东西,必备) 监控ie/ff/chrome, 把请求的js文件存下来(需要decode gzip,还有jsbeautiful格式化下)
3)搜索 www.mxgraph.com,把下面这段屏蔽掉
/* if (window.location.hostname != 'mxgraph.com' && window.location.hostname != 'www.mxgraph.com') { var st = document.getElementsByTagName('script'); for (var i = 0, len = st.length, mxu = 'http://www.mxgraph.com/demo/mxgraph/src/js/mxclient.php'; i < len && st[i].src.indexOf(mxu) < 0; i++); if (i == len) { if ((new Date().getTime() / 1000) - 1262140094 > 15778463) { mxGraph = null; }; mxUtils.get(mxu + '?version=local[' + document.cookie + ']&key=' + window.location.href + '[1.2.0.5]'); } }; */
4)其他文件(css,property,gif...)一样通过fiddler监控,然后下载即可
5)对比3个js文件,把一些true/false的地方换为浏览器判断即可 (附件中犯懒没有做这步)
3.其他
...